Another benefit of a lightweight folding power wheelchair is that it's lightweight and portable, making it easy to transport and store. Certain models can be transported in the back or trunk of a vehicle, while others can be used on planes (subject to airline approval). Additionally they typically come with lithium-ion batteries with detachable connectors that can be charged off-board, so you don't need the entire wheelchair for your travels. Depending on your needs you can also buy more than one battery, so you always have backup batteries in case in the event of an emergency.

The Oracle Side Folding Motorized Wheelchair is another electric wheelchair that is lightweight that is ideal for travel. Its sturdy aluminum frame is light and sturdy, while its suspensions at the front and rear ensure an easy ride. It can be used on a variety surfaces including plush carpets, wood or tile flooring and threshold ramps. Oracle can be used in many different environments. Its lightweight design allows it to be carried by caregivers and users.

The Oracle is also built with two 8ah Lithium-Ion batteries that are connected to provide greater range, driving time, and convenience. The Oracle's batteries are rechargeable independently of the chair, and each battery is equipped with a quick release feature for easy removal. This feature makes the Oracle one of the best choices for travelers as it is able to be used on airplanes cruise ships, trains or public transportation as well as taxi cabs. It comes with a bag for travel and extra batteries.
